Package net.minecraft.client.multiplayer
Class ServerData
java.lang.Object
net.minecraft.client.multiplayer.ServerData
- 
Nested Class SummaryNested ClassesModifier and TypeClassDescriptionstatic enumstatic enum
- 
Field SummaryFieldsModifier and TypeFieldDescriptionprivate booleanprivate byte[]private static final org.slf4j.Loggerprivate static final intprivate ServerData.ServerPackStatuslongbooleanintprivate ServerData.Type
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ionvoidcopyFrom(ServerData p_105382_) voidcopyNameIconFrom(ServerData p_233804_) booleanbyte[]booleanisLan()booleanisRealm()static ServerDataread(CompoundTag p_105386_) voidsetEnforcesSecureChat(boolean p_242972_) voidsetIconBytes(byte[] p_272760_) voidsetResourcePackStatus(ServerData.ServerPackStatus p_105380_) type()static byte[]validateIcon(byte[] p_302394_) write()
- 
Field Details- 
LOGGERprivate static final org.slf4j.Logger LOGGER
- 
MAX_ICON_SIZEprivate static final int MAX_ICON_SIZE- See Also:
 
- 
name
- 
ip
- 
status
- 
motd
- 
players
- 
pingpublic long ping
- 
protocolpublic int protocol
- 
version
- 
pingedpublic boolean pinged
- 
playerList
- 
packStatus
- 
iconBytes@Nullable private byte[] iconBytes
- 
type
- 
enforcesSecureChatprivate boolean enforcesSecureChat
- 
neoForgeData
 
- 
- 
Constructor Details- 
ServerData
 
- 
- 
Method Details- 
write
- 
getResourcePackStatus
- 
setResourcePackStatus
- 
read
- 
getIconBytes@Nullable public byte[] getIconBytes()
- 
setIconBytespublic void setIconBytes(@Nullable byte[] p_272760_) 
- 
isLanpublic boolean isLan()
- 
isRealmpublic boolean isRealm()
- 
type
- 
setEnforcesSecureChatpublic void setEnforcesSecureChat(boolean p_242972_) 
- 
enforcesSecureChatpublic boolean enforcesSecureChat()
- 
copyNameIconFrom
- 
copyFrom
- 
validateIcon@Nullable public static byte[] validateIcon(@Nullable byte[] p_302394_) 
 
-